About Xiang Zou
Xiang Zou is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Biotechnology and Pollution, having authored 100 papers that have together received 2.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Biofuel production and bioconversion (22 papers), Polysaccharides and Plant Cell Walls (22 papers) and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biotechnology (216 citations), Food Science (411 citations) and Building and Construction (218 citations). Xiang Zou has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Min Sun, Shang‐Tian Yang, Junguo He, Yijie Zhong, Pengfei Zhang, Xinlei Pan, Jie Zhang, Jun Feng, Yipin Zhou and Ju Chu.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Biomaterials and The Science of The Total Environment.
